400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 综合分类 > 文章详情

setupui.dll计算机丢失或缺少("setupui.dll缺失")

作者:路由通
|
139人看过
发布时间:2025-06-13 00:23:42
标签:
综合评述:setupui.dll丢失或缺少的问题 setupui.dll是Windows系统中与安装程序界面相关的动态链接库文件,通常由软件安装包或系统组件调用。当该文件缺失或损坏时,用户可能会遇到程序安装失败、系统功能异常甚至蓝屏等问题。
setupui.dll计算机丢失或缺少("setupui.dll缺失")
setupui.dll丢失或缺少的问题

setupui.dll是Windows系统中与安装程序界面相关的动态链接库文件,通常由软件安装包或系统组件调用。当该文件缺失或损坏时,用户可能会遇到程序安装失败、系统功能异常甚至蓝屏等问题。这一问题可能由多种原因引起,包括病毒感染、误删除、系统更新冲突、软件卸载残留或硬盘错误等。由于setupui.dll涉及系统底层功能,其缺失可能对普通用户的操作体验造成显著影响。

s	etupui.dll计算机丢失或缺少

解决此类问题需要系统性排查,既要考虑文件本身的恢复,也要分析潜在的系统环境问题。不同平台的修复方式可能存在差异,例如Windows 10与Windows 11的权限管理机制不同,32位和64位系统的文件路径也有区别。此外,用户需警惕非官方渠道下载的替代文件可能携带恶意代码。接下来,我们将从八个维度展开详细解决方案,涵盖从基础操作到深度修复的全流程。

一、系统文件检查工具(SFC与DISM)的运用

setupui.dll丢失时,首先应使用Windows内置的系统文件检查工具。SFC(System File Checker)可扫描并修复受保护的系统文件,而DISM(Deployment Image Servicing and Management)则用于修复系统映像底层问题。


  • 步骤1:以管理员身份运行CMD,输入sfc /scannow命令。此过程可能需要20-30分钟,期间系统会自动替换损坏或缺失的文件。

  • 步骤2:若SFC未能解决问题,依次执行以下DISM命令:DISM /Online /Cleanup-Image /CheckHealthDISM /Online /Cleanup-Image /ScanHealth,最后使用DISM /Online /Cleanup-Image /RestoreHealth进行修复。

  • 注意事项:需确保网络连接稳定,DISM会从Windows Update下载健康文件;若系统更新服务被禁用,需提前开启。

对于特殊场景,如系统隔离环境,可使用离线修复模式:将安装镜像挂载为虚拟驱动器后,通过DISM /Online /Cleanup-Image /RestoreHealth /Source:WIM:X:SourcesInstall.wim:1 /LimitAccess指定源路径。此方法尤其适用于企业域控环境或定制化系统。

二、手动注册DLL文件的完整流程

如果确认setupui.dll存在于系统目录但未被正确注册,需通过Regsvr32工具手动注册。此操作要求文件本身未损坏且版本匹配当前系统。


  • 步骤1:定位文件位置。64位系统需检查C:WindowsSystem32C:WindowsSysWOW64两个目录,32位系统仅需查看C:WindowsSystem32

  • 步骤2:注册文件。在对应目录的地址栏输入cmd直接打开命令行,执行regsvr32 setupui.dll。若提示权限不足,需先取得文件所有权。

  • 错误处理:若返回"模块已加载但找不到入口点",表明文件版本不兼容;若提示"拒绝访问",需关闭杀毒软件实时防护或检查组策略限制。

高级用户可通过Process Monitor工具监控注册过程,查看具体的CLSID注册失败原因。对于需要数字签名的系统版本,还需验证文件签名状态:sigverif.exe可列出所有未签名的系统文件。

三、从可信来源获取DLL文件的注意事项

当需要重新下载setupui.dll时,务必选择微软官方或经过WHQL认证的渠道。第三方DLL仓库存在极大安全风险,可能包含木马或勒索病毒。


  • 安全下载途径:通过微软官方支持页面获取系统更新包;或从原始软件安装介质(如ISO文件)中提取纯净副本。

  • 版本匹配原则:需核对文件版本号、语言、位数(x86/x64)及时间戳。右键属性查看详细信息,重点比对"文件版本"和"产品版本"字段。

  • 哈希值验证:使用CertUtil计算SHA256哈希值,与官方发布记录比对。例如:CertUtil -hashfile setupui.dll SHA256

对于特殊版本系统(如LTSC或Server Core),建议通过对应版本的累积更新包获取文件。避免跨系统版本替换文件,可能引发连锁兼容性问题。企业环境中可使用WSUS或SCCM集中分发已验证文件。

四、系统还原与回滚操作指南

如果setupui.dll缺失源于近期系统变更,利用系统还原点是高效解决方案。此方法可保留用户数据的同时恢复系统文件。


  • 触发条件检查:在控制面板中确认系统保护是否启用,查看可用还原点列表。默认情况下,Windows每周创建还原点,重大更新前也会自动生成。

  • 执行还原:通过rstrui.exe启动向导,选择问题出现前的日期点。注意还原过程不可逆,建议提前备份关键数据。

  • 增强模式:在安全模式下运行系统还原可避免驱动程序冲突;若图形界面失效,可通过WinRE环境中的命令行工具执行。

对于没有启用系统保护的用户,可尝试回滚最近的Windows更新:在"设置-更新与安全-查看更新历史记录"中卸载最新质量更新。企业域成员计算机需注意组策略可能限制此功能。

五、病毒查杀与系统安全加固

部分恶意软件会故意删除或替换系统DLL文件。彻底清除病毒是解决setupui.dll问题的前提条件。


  • 深度扫描方案:交替使用Windows Defender离线扫描和第三方工具(如Malwarebytes)进行交叉检测。重点排查注册表H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ionRun中的异常项。

  • 后门检测:使用Autoruns工具分析所有自动启动项,特别注意已被修改图像路径的DLL文件。

  • 系统加固:启用受控文件夹访问(CFA)功能,保护System32目录不被篡改;配置SRP(软件限制策略)阻止非常规位置DLL加载。

对于高级持续性威胁(APT),建议重置Hosts文件、清理WMI存储库并检查计划任务。企业环境应部署EDR解决方案实时监控DLL注入行为。

六、磁盘错误检测与修复技术

硬盘坏道或文件系统错误可能导致setupui.dll读取失败。底层存储介质健康状态直接影响文件完整性。


  • CHKDSK全盘检测:运行chkdsk C: /f /r /x(需重启后执行),参数说明:/f修复错误,/r定位坏扇区,/x强制卸载卷。

  • SMART诊断:通过CrystalDiskInfo查看硬盘健康状态,关注"重新分配扇区计数"和"寻道错误率"等关键指标。

  • 文件系统修复:使用fsutil dirty query C:检查卷脏位状态,必要时用fsutil repair set C: 0x1触发自修复。

对于固态硬盘,需额外关注写入寿命和NAND损耗情况。频繁出现文件损坏时,应考虑更换存储设备并迁移系统。

七、软件冲突诊断与隔离方案

某些安全软件或系统优化工具会误判setupui.dll为威胁而隔离。需系统化排查软件兼容性问题。


  • 干净启动诊断:通过msconfig禁用所有非Microsoft服务,在任务管理器中关闭启动项,逐步排除冲突来源。

  • 进程监视:使用Process Explorer查看DLL加载树,定位尝试访问缺失文件的父进程。

  • 虚拟化测试:通过Windows Sandbox或虚拟机创建纯净环境,复现问题以确认是否与主系统配置相关。

特别注意以下高冲突软件:驱动程序更新工具、注册表清理器、旧版杀毒软件。建议创建软件黑白名单机制,对关键系统目录设置写入保护。

八、系统级重置与重装决策分析

当所有修复手段无效时,系统重置或重装可能是终极解决方案。需根据实际情况选择保留文件或彻底清理。


  • 云下载重置:Windows 10/11内置"重置此电脑"功能,选择"保留我的文件"选项可最小化数据损失。

  • 媒体创建工具:通过官方工具制作安装U盘,执行覆盖安装(不格式化分区)可保留已安装程序。

  • 全盘擦除重装:针对反复出现文件损坏的情况,建议备份数据后彻底重新分区安装,消除底层文件系统隐患。

企业环境中建议使用标准化部署工具:Windows Autopilot可自动化完成驱动匹配和策略应用;MDT/SCCM组合支持批量自定义镜像分发。重装后应立即创建系统映像备份,便于后续快速恢复。

在实际操作过程中,用户需根据具体错误提示选择针对性方案。例如,若错误代码显示为0xc000012f,表明DLL初始化失败,此时应优先考虑系统更新或重注册COM组件;而错误0x80070002则指向文件路径问题,需检查环境变量设置和文件实际存储位置。

对于需要长期稳定运行的生产环境,建议建立系统文件监控机制:通过PowerShell脚本定期校验关键DLL的哈希值,结合Windows事件日志分析早期异常。同时,保持月度系统映像备份的习惯,可大幅降低因文件丢失导致的停机风险。

s	etupui.dll计算机丢失或缺少

值得深入探讨的是,现代Windows系统已引入组件存储(WinSxS)冗余机制,理论上重要系统文件都有多版本备份。但当该机制自身损坏时,会出现更复杂的修复场景,此时可能需要专业人员介入处理。普通用户掌握基本修复方法后,90%以上的setupui.dll相关问题都能自主解决。

相关文章
光猫接路由器哪个孔(光猫接路由器哪个口)
光猫接路由器哪个孔?全方位深度解析 光猫接路由器哪个孔?全方位深度解析 在现代家庭和办公网络环境中,光猫和路由器的连接方式直接影响网络性能和稳定性。正确选择光猫的接口连接路由器是构建高效网络的第一步。光猫通常配备多个接口,包括千兆网口、i
2025-06-13 17:26:21
171人看过
微信请帖是怎么制作的(微信请帖制作方法)
微信请帖制作全方位解析 微信请帖作为数字化社交的重要载体,已逐渐取代传统纸质请柬,成为婚礼、生日宴、商务活动等场景的首选邀请方式。其核心优势在于高效传播、互动性强和成本低廉。用户可通过第三方平台或自主设计工具,快速生成融合多媒体元素的动态
2025-06-13 00:54:23
52人看过
个人抖音怎么运营(抖音个人运营)
个人抖音运营全方位攻略 在当今短视频爆发的时代,抖音作为国内领先的短视频平台,已成为个人品牌打造和内容创业的重要阵地。个人抖音运营不仅需要创意和坚持,更需要系统化的策略和方法。成功的抖音账号往往在内容定位、用户互动、数据分析等方面有着独到
2025-06-12 21:44:07
293人看过
cg.dll计算机丢失或缺少("丢失cg.dll")
综合评述 cg.dll是某些应用程序或游戏运行所需的动态链接库文件,其丢失或损坏会导致程序无法启动或运行时崩溃。这一问题多出现在Windows操作系统中,尤其是因系统文件损坏、软件安装异常、病毒攻击或驱动程序冲突等因素引发。用户可能遇到“
2025-06-12 20:05:37
283人看过
路由器怎么连接到主路由器(主路由器连接方法)
路由器连接到主路由器的全方位指南 在现代网络环境中,将路由器连接到主路由器是一项常见的网络扩展操作,能够有效扩大无线覆盖范围、优化信号强度并实现多设备管理。无论是家庭用户还是企业场景,正确连接路由器需要综合考虑硬件兼容性、网络协议、安全设
2025-06-12 17:29:18
146人看过
微信二维码收款后怎么联系对方(收款后联系对方)
微信二维码收款后联系对方全方位指南 在移动支付普及的今天,微信二维码收款已成为日常交易的重要方式。然而收款后需要联系付款方时,由于微信设计的隐私保护机制,往往面临联系渠道受限的困境。本文将从八个维度系统剖析可行的联系方式,对比不同场景下的
2025-06-12 14:54:24
127人看过